The bachelor's program at Sagrado was ranked #1,569 on College Factual's Best Schools for nursing list. It is also ranked #9 in Puerto Rico.
During the 2020-2021 academic year, Universidad del Sagrado Corazon handed out 138 bachelor's degrees in nursing. This is a decrease of 61% over the previous year when 353 degrees were handed out.
The median salary of nursing students who receive their bachelor's degree at Sagrado is $37,911. Unfortunately, this is lower than the national average of $62,880 for all nursing students.
While getting their bachelor's degree at Sagrado, nursing students borrow a median amount of $23,000 in student loans. This is not too bad considering that the median debt load of all nursing bachelor's degree recipients across the country is $27,000.
